数据库 · 7 11 月, 2024

如何利用SQL文件生成數據庫? (sql文件生成數據庫)

如何利用SQL文件生成數據庫?

在當今的數據驅動世界中,數據庫的管理和操作變得越來越重要。SQL(結構化查詢語言)是一種用於管理和操作關係型數據庫的標準語言。本文將探討如何利用SQL文件生成數據庫,並提供一些實用的示例和步驟。

什麼是SQL文件?

SQL文件是一種文本文件,通常以“.sql”為擴展名,包含了一系列的SQL語句。這些語句可以用來創建數據庫、表格、插入數據、更新數據等。SQL文件的主要優勢在於它可以被重複使用,並且可以在不同的數據庫系統之間進行轉移。

生成數據庫的步驟

以下是利用SQL文件生成數據庫的基本步驟:

1. 準備SQL文件

首先,您需要創建一個SQL文件,該文件包含創建數據庫和表格的語句。以下是一個簡單的示例:

-- 創建數據庫
CREATE DATABASE my_database;

-- 使用數據庫
USE my_database;

-- 創建表格
CREATE TABLE users (
    id INT AUTO_INCREMENT PRIMARY KEY,
    username VARCHAR(50) NOT NULL,
    email VARCHAR(100) NOT NULL,
    created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);

2. 連接到數據庫服務器

在執行SQL文件之前,您需要連接到數據庫服務器。這可以通過命令行工具或數據庫管理工具來完成。例如,使用MySQL命令行工具,您可以使用以下命令連接到數據庫:

mysql -u username -p

在提示符下輸入您的密碼以完成連接。

3. 執行SQL文件

一旦您成功連接到數據庫服務器,就可以執行SQL文件。使用MySQL命令行工具,您可以使用以下命令來執行SQL文件:

source /path/to/your/file.sql;

這條命令將執行SQL文件中的所有語句,從而創建數據庫和表格。

4. 驗證數據庫和表格的創建

執行完SQL文件後,您可以使用以下命令來檢查數據庫和表格是否成功創建:

SHOW DATABASES;
USE my_database;
SHOW TABLES;

這些命令將顯示所有可用的數據庫和當前數據庫中的所有表格。

注意事項

  • 確保SQL文件的語法正確,否則在執行時可能會出現錯誤。
  • 在執行SQL文件之前,建議先備份現有的數據庫,以防止數據丟失。
  • 根據不同的數據庫管理系統(如MySQL、PostgreSQL等),SQL語法可能會有所不同,請根據具體情況進行調整。

總結

利用SQL文件生成數據庫是一個高效且靈活的過程。通過準備好SQL文件、連接到數據庫服務器並執行相應的命令,您可以輕鬆地創建和管理數據庫。這對於開發者和數據庫管理員來說都是一項重要的技能。如果您需要穩定的數據庫服務,考慮使用香港VPS香港伺服器來支持您的應用程序和數據存儲需求。